Musiala Opens Up on Injury Comeback: Bayern Star Targets 2025 Return

Bayern Munich’s midfield sensation Jamal Musiala has finally shared details of his ongoing recovery journey following the long-term injury that sidelined him earlier this year. The 22-year-old, who suffered a broken fibula during the FIFA Club World Cup, admitted the road back has been challenging but remains optimistic about a return to competitive football before the end of 2025.

In an exclusive interview with Sport Bild, Musiala revealed encouraging signs of progress. “My foot is fine and the healing process is going according to plan. I don’t need crutches anymore,” he said with a smile, before stressing the importance of patience. “I don’t want to rush things; I want to take as much time as I need.”

The injury, which came at a time when Musiala was cementing himself as one of Bayern’s most influential players, left both fans and the club stunned. Known for his dribbling flair, creativity, and composure beyond his years, his absence has been deeply felt in the Bundesliga champions’ midfield. Yet, Musiala admitted that the hardest part wasn’t physical but mental.

“Mentally, the first few weeks weren’t easy for me. But it won’t help if I’m constantly annoyed by the situation,” he explained. Instead of dwelling on frustration, the German international has decided to use his time wisely. “I want to focus on other things now and take the time to do the things I don’t normally have time for. Then the time will pass more quickly until I’m back on the pitch.”

  • Musiala also highlighted the unpredictable nature of recovery from such injuries. “You never know what steps you’ll take at any given moment. Sometimes things are going great, and then I slow down for three days. I’m taking my time and I don’t want to set a date yet,” he said. However, he remained hopeful, adding: “Based on the progress I’ve made so far, I’d say that I’ll still be playing competitive matches with FC Bayern in 2025. When I return to the pitch, I want to be ready.”
